Information and communications technology have a significant impact on many aspects of human life. One of the ways through which IT has transformed human social life is through the use of e-commerce. Nanotechnology as a novel field of science is developing at a high rate. As a result, today more than 1200 companies around the world are manufacturing and distributing nanoproducts in the market. Some of these companies specialize in manufacturing nanoproducts that can be used for environmental applications. Nanotechnology, as a scientific field, can play a significant role in the world economy in near future. In terms of the science of Information Technology and IT Absorptive Capacity Theory, the findings of this study confirm the overall positive impact of the development of e-commerce on environmental nanoproducts. This study, while introducing IT Absorptive Capacity Theory, provides an experimental study of the impact of the development of e-commerce for nanoproducts for environmental applications. The study findings indicate that the absorption capacity of e-commerce of the nanoproducts for environmental application has a positive impact on the development of e-commerce of environmental nanoproducts.
